#7a578b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7a578b is composed of 47.8% red, 34.1%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.2% cyan, 37.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 280.4 degrees, a saturation of 23% and a lightness of 44.3%. #7a578b color hex could be obtained by blending #f4aeff with #000017.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#7a578b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060406 is the darkest color, while #fbf9fb is the lightest one.
